Output dee3d96774b4f44a0e4e2511d4d3079e27957094a665d609a23194a7cb93d75f:1

value
10040747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fd68e5b196959a62b17c188aff5b5a9a4fd7d76 OP_EQUAL
address
3GGAPfNbNLRdYgi5raYiXAggBMYFG7Dif3
transaction
dee3d96774b4f44a0e4e2511d4d3079e27957094a665d609a23194a7cb93d75f
confirmations
253913
spent
true